Message type: E = Error
Message class: IUUC_TAB - IUUC: Messages for table analysis
Message number: 146
Message text: Call to remote system failed, either for '&1' or '&2'

- Call to remote system failed, either for '&1' or '&2' ?The SAP error message IUUC_TAB146 indicates that there was a failure in calling a remote system, which can occur in scenarios involving data replication or communication between systems, particularly in the context of SAP Landscape Transformation (SLT) or SAP Data Services.
Cause:
The error can be caused by several factors, including:
Network Issues: There may be connectivity problems between the source and target systems, such as network outages, firewall restrictions, or incorrect network configurations.
Configuration Errors: The remote system may not be properly configured in the SLT or Data Services settings. This includes incorrect RFC (Remote Function Call) destinations or missing authorizations.
System Availability: The remote system might be down or not reachable due to maintenance or other issues.
Data Consistency Issues: There may be inconsistencies in the data being replicated, which can lead to failures in processing.
Authorization Issues: The user credentials used for the connection may not have the necessary permissions to access the remote system.
Solution:
To resolve the IUUC_TAB146 error, you can take the following steps:
Check Network Connectivity:
- Ensure that the network connection between the systems is stable and operational.
- Use tools like
ping
ortraceroute
to verify connectivity.Verify RFC Configuration:
- Check the RFC destination settings in transaction
SM59
to ensure they are correctly configured.- Test the RFC connection to see if it is working properly.
Check System Status:
- Verify that the remote system is up and running. Check for any scheduled maintenance or downtime.
Review Authorizations:
- Ensure that the user credentials used for the connection have the necessary authorizations to access the remote system.
Examine Logs:
- Check the SLT logs (transaction
SLG1
) or other relevant logs for more detailed error messages that can provide additional context about the failure.Data Consistency Checks:
- If applicable, check for any data consistency issues that may be causing the replication to fail.
Consult SAP Notes:
- Look for rel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error or provide additional troubleshooting steps.
